Summary:

"Following the enormous success of the Great Exhibition of 1851, expositions have been held in Europe, America and Asia and provided a stage on which the world has come together to display its achievement and ambitions. These momentous events have also exerted a profound influence on developments in architecture and urban planning, transportation, mass communication, consumerism, science, technology, art, industrial design, popular culture, entertainment and leisure. The revolver, sewing machine, telephone and television have all had their public launch at, expositions, the Eiffel Tower in Paris and Atomium in Brussels were purpose-built for expositions, and one of the greatest paintings of the twentieth century, Pablo Picasso's Guernica, was created specifically for display at the 1937 Paris exposition." "This book accompanies a touring exhibition originated by the Bureau International des Expositions and is written around three broad themes: the city transformed, the world displayed and the future represented. It bridges the gap between a general overview and academic text, providing a lively introduction to the history and significance of international expositions. The experience of visiting an 'expo' was essentially a visual one and the objects featured here are primarily graphic: posters, ephemera, photographs, books and catalogues, all of which help trace the development of these events and the changing ways in which they were recorded as technology advanced, from hand-tinted print to aerial colour photograph."--Jacket.
